Chionanthus retusus ‘Arnold’s Pride’
A great selection of Chinese fringetree from Arnold Arboretum with abundant, fragrant spring flowers and exfoliating cinnamon bark. A strong grower with a central leader and shiny dark green leaves. Chionanthus retusus
[gallery ids="5612"]
A small rounded tree that has leathery, glossy foliage. The white, mid-spring flowers are produced in erect 3" long clusters, covering the tree. If a female, purple-black fruit appears in fall. Calluna vulgaris ‘Silver Knight’
[gallery ids="5610,5611"]
A groundcover shrub that forms a fine textured, dense mat. The single blooms are lavender and the foliage is silvery-gray. The blooms appear in July thru September. It grows best in full sun in an acidic, well-drained soil. Shear lightly after flowering to maintain a tidy form....
